Growth protocol |
The kidney was harvested, placed on ice and a piece consisting of both outer medulla and cortex was excised. The kidney tissue was homogenised in lysis buffer (Macherey Nagel, Düren, Germany) on a TissueLyser LT (Qiagen, Venlo, Netherlands) for 30 seconds at 1,250 rpm and centrifuged at 1000 × g for 10 minutes at 4°C.

Data processing |
Raw data were processed with the Affymetrix Console Software according to the RMA. Normalized gene expression data was analysed in the open source software Multiexperiment Viewer version 4.9.0, which is part of the TM4 microarray software suite.The statistical analysis was done by employing the Significance Analysis of Microarrays (SAM)-method. The number of permutations was set to 200, S0 was selected according to the method by Tusher et al, and the K-nearest neighbors method for imputation of missing data, with k = 10, was used. Unpaired two-class analysis was performed. A false discovery rate (FDR) of 10% was selected.
